Key Features to Look for in Security Flashlights with High-Intensity Lights

security guard

When selecting a flashlight for security personnel, high-intensity lights are paramount for identifying intruders and navigating various environments effectively. A robust flashlight not only illuminates dark spaces but also serves as a deterrent and a tool for situational awareness. Key features to prioritize include a durable construction to withstand the rigors of fieldwork, a focused beam capable of reaching considerable distances, and adjustable intensity settings to conserve battery life when lower lumens are sufficient.

The best flashlights for security personnel offer a balance between brightness, battery life, and portability without compromising on sturdiness or functionality. Rechargeable models with lithium-ion batteries provide longer operational times compared to alkaline counterparts. Additionally, features such as strobe and SOS functions can be crucial in disorienting an adversary or signaling for assistance. Impact resistance and a high-strength body, often made from aircraft-grade aluminum, ensure the flashlight remains operational even after accidental drops or encounters with physical threats. It is also beneficial to consider models with tactical accessories, such as holsters or wearable options, which can facilitate hands-free operation during critical situations.

Best Practices for Training Security Personnel on Using High-Intensity Light Flashlights

security guard

Security personnel play a pivotal role in safeguarding properties and ensuring the safety of individuals. When equipped with high-intensity light flashlights, such as those offering LED illumination, they can effectively identify potential intruders in low-light conditions. To maximize the efficacy of these devices, it is imperative to integrate comprehensive training into the regular regimen of security staff. This training should encompass both theoretical knowledge about the flashlight’s capabilities and practical exercises that simulate real-world scenarios.

A key best practice involves familiarizing personnel with the different light modes available on high-intensity flashlights, such as momentary-on, continuous-on, and strobe settings. Each mode serves a distinct purpose, from maintaining situational awareness to disorienting an assailant. Training should also emphasize proper grip and handling techniques to avoid accidental setting changes during critical moments. Additionally, scenarios that incorporate the use of these flashlights in conjunction with other security measures, like surveillance equipment or audible alarms, will prepare personnel for coordinated responses. Regular drills and real-life simulations are essential to reinforce the skills acquired during training, ensuring that when faced with an intruder, security personnel can effectively deploy their high-intensity light flashlights to protect people and properties.
